There are many varieties of disposable gloves but the two major varieties which are used in relation to hygiene are cleaning gloves and dishwashing gloves. The disposable gloves which are meant to serve as cleaning gloves are resistant to chemicals like acids, alkalis, alcohols, detergents, harsh cleaners, pesticides and solvents. Likewise, the dish-washing gloves are meant for the purpose of protecting the hands of the person who indulges in dishwashing and cleaning. Since disposable gloves are especially required for tasks which involve manual dexterity and tactile sensitivity they are a must in industries concerned with cleaning, food processing, food service and light industrial applications. Safety signs are classified as visual alerting devices which are eye catching in appearance and consist of a signal word, a message or a pictorial symbol in a particular color. The main purpose of the safety signs is to convey the intended message to the onlooker so that he is warned of the potential hazard and can subsequently take the necessary precaution and appropriate action.
